Job Posting: Registered Sanitarian/Sanitarian-in-Training
Registered Sanitarian/Sanitarian-in-Training
The Champaign Health District seeks an F/T Sanitarian-in-Training or Registered Sanitarian to work in the Environmental Health Division. This position is responsible for but not be limited to: food service operations and retail food establishments, vending, schools, camps, swimming pools and spas, body art establishments, jail, housing units, sewage treatment systems, private water/wells, water samples, solid waste disposal, construction and demolition debris landfills, refuse hauling and /or septage hauling vehicles, water hauling vehicles, vector control and rabies control; investigates foodborne or other illnesses and public health nuisances; collects water and effluent samples; performs routine tests according to established health district policy and procedures to enforce state and local laws, and rules and regulations.
Requirements:
The successful candidate must be able to communicate professionally and effectively both orally and in writing. BA/BS degree, Ohio driver license, and State of Ohio Registered Sanitarian license or requirements to apply for a State of Ohio Sanitarian-in-Training license required (as described in ORC 4736.08). Occasional weekend or evening work may be required.
